Army Makes Headway in Rescue of Abducted Oyo Pupils, Teachers — COAS

The Chief of Army Staff (COAS), Lt.-Gen. Waidi Shaibu, has assured Nigerians that military troops are making significant progress in efforts to rescue the 39 pupils and seven teachers abducted from schools in Oyo State.

Shaibu gave the assurance on Saturday during an interactive session with media executives in Port Harcourt as part of activities marking the 2026 Nigerian Army Day Celebration.

The victims were kidnapped on May 15, 2026, from three schools in Orire Local Government Area of Oyo State, sparking widespread concern over the safety of students and educational institutions in the region.

Providing an update on the rescue mission, the Army Chief expressed optimism that ongoing operations would soon secure the victims’ freedom.

“Operations are currently ongoing to rescue those children abducted in Oyo State, and we are making tremendous progress,” Shaibu said.

He expressed confidence that the military would safely reunite the abducted pupils and teachers with their families.

Army Records Gains Across Security Operations

Beyond the Oyo rescue operation, Shaibu highlighted the Nigerian Army’s achievements in combating insecurity across the country’s six geopolitical zones.

According to him, troops deployed under Operation Hadin Kai in the North-East have continued to record major victories against insurgents and terrorist groups.

He disclosed that the operation recently eliminated a high-profile commander of the Islamic State terrorist group, Abu-Bilal al-Minuki, during a joint operation carried out with support from United States partners.

Shaibu revealed that troops under Operation Hadin Kai had neutralised more than 1,872 insurgents, while several terrorists had voluntarily surrendered.

He added that the improved security situation in the North-East had enabled thousands of internally displaced persons (IDPs) to return to their communities, citing the recent closure of the Bama Internally Displaced Persons Camp in Borno State as a major milestone.

Operations Intensified Against Bandits and Criminals

The Army Chief also highlighted successes recorded in the North-West under Operation Fansan Yamma, noting that troops had continued to dismantle bandit networks through sustained offensives.

He said numerous criminal elements had been neutralised, while large caches of weapons and ammunition had been recovered during recent operations.

In the North-Central region, Shaibu said military operations under Enduring Freedom, Whirlwind and the newly established Operation Savannah Shield had significantly strengthened security in Plateau, Benue, Nasarawa, Kwara, Niger and parts of Kogi states.

Improved Security in South-East, South-South and South-West

Speaking on the security situation in the South-East, the COAS said conditions had improved considerably.

He noted that there were no significant security disruptions during the last Christmas celebrations, describing it as evidence of the effectiveness of ongoing military operations in the region.

In the South-South, Shaibu said the Army’s sustained crackdown on illegal oil bunkering, crude oil theft and pipeline vandalism had contributed to increased national crude oil production.

According to him, the improvement in oil output reflects the success of military operations aimed at protecting critical national assets.

He further described the South-West as one of Nigeria’s most peaceful regions, except for the recent kidnapping of pupils and teachers in Oyo State.

Tinubu Approves New Army Depot, Expanded Recruitment

Shaibu disclosed that President Bola Tinubu had approved measures aimed at strengthening the Nigerian Army’s manpower to meet emerging security challenges.

Among the approvals, he said, was the establishment of a new Nigerian Army Depot at Amasiri-Edda in Ebonyi State, bringing the total number of army depots nationwide to three.

The existing depots are located in Zaria, Kaduna State, and Osogbo, Osun State.

According to the COAS, the three depots are expected to recruit and train about 28,000 young Nigerians.

He explained that the recruitment drive was designed to boost the Army’s operational capacity across various theatres of operation.

“So far, the Zaria depot has graduated 6,000 soldiers, Osogbo has graduated 5,000, while Amasiri-Edda will soon graduate 3,000, bringing the total number of newly trained personnel to 14,000,” he said.

Army Upgrades Training and Equipment

Shaibu said the Nigerian Army had also reviewed its training curriculum to better prepare recruits for modern warfare.

The revised programme places greater emphasis on marksmanship, counter-insurgency operations and counter-terrorism tactics.

He noted that recruits now undergo approximately 11 months of intensive military training, including advanced infantry exercises and acclimatisation programmes.

To enhance operational effectiveness, the Army has acquired additional armoured personnel carriers, mine-resistant vehicles and unmanned aerial vehicles (UAVs).

The COAS added that military personnel are also receiving specialised training within Nigeria and overseas to ensure they can effectively operate modern combat equipment.

According to him, the deployment of armed and surveillance drones, alongside improved aviation capabilities, has significantly enhanced the Army’s response time and operational success across various theatres of operation.

Shaibu reaffirmed the Nigerian Army’s commitment to defending the nation’s territorial integrity and responding decisively to evolving security threats while assuring Nigerians that efforts to rescue the abducted Oyo pupils and teachers remain a top operational priority.
